name=rb_ary_entry
private=false
macro=false
type=VALUE
filename=array.c
params=(VALUE ary, long offset)


ary Υǥå offset Ǥ֤ޤ

ǥåϰϤۤȤ Qnil ֤ޤ
ΥǥåȤޤ

бRuby

  ary[offset] ޤ
  ary.at(offset)



  VALUE num;
  num = rb_ary_entry(ary, offset); 
  printf("%d\n", FIX2INT(num));

  㥹ȤȤäǤλˡ
  
  VALUE num = RARRAY(ary)->ptr[offset];

